McLaren Macomb has launched Bravo for Women, a free mammogram program for uninsured women in Macomb County.
The program is designed to ensure women without health insurance have access to mammograms. Funding was provided through BRAvo, a yearly event designed to increase awareness of breast cancer issues and prevention.
To qualify for a mammogram, women must be at least 40 (or younger than 40 with a family history of breast cancer or physician referral) and meet certain income eligibility requirements.

The BRAvo event features the winning entries in a bra-decorating challenge and a live auction of celebrity-autographed bras.
BRAvo Night is at 6 p.m. Oct. 10 at the Mirage, 16980 Eighteen Mile Road in Clinton Township. The theme is “Mardi Bra: Unmasking Breast Cancer.”
